The link between gloss and colour perception is based on how light interacts with the surface of the wallpaper. The lacquer covering this paper can vary in terms of gloss, creating a spectrum of visual possibilities, ranging from super matt to gloss to matt to satin.
1. Hue and Shimmer:
Shimmer, acting as a link between dull and vibrant, can amplify the intensity of a colour, giving it greater prominence in space. Thus, a deep red hue on a high gloss paper can become an instant eye-catching focal point. In contrast, matte finishes exert the opposite influence, softening colours and giving them a serene, elegant feel.
Similarly, gloss, beyond its influence on the relationship between colours, changes the way colours interact with light. On high-gloss surfaces, light is reflected intensely, generating pronounced contrasts and dramatic highlights. In contrast, matt surfaces diffuse light evenly, resulting in a softer, more delicate palette overall.
2. Stylistic Coherence:
The choice of gloss is not only about intensifying or softening colours, but also about maintaining coherence with the overall style of the space. So glossy surfaces may be ideal for modern and bold environments, while matt surfaces would be better suited to relaxed and serene environments.

In the world of furniture manufacturing, two types of coatings stand out for both their aesthetic and functional benefits: Finish Foil and CPL. These materials have revolutionised the furniture industry thanks to their ability to enhance the appearance and durability of products.
Finish Foil is a thin, decorative, resin-impregnated material used to cover the surface of furniture. With a wide range of decorative options, including woodgrain, unicolour and fantasy designs, manufacturers can create attractive finishes to suit different decorating styles. In addition to its decorative function, Finish Foil provides resistance and protection against stains and scratches, maintaining the original appearance of the furniture for a long time.
CPL, or Continuous Pressure Laminate, is a continuous sheet manufactured by applying heat and pressure to several layers of paper impregnated with thermosetting resins. This coating stands out for its high resistance to impacts, abrasions and scratches, which ensures that the furniture maintains its integrity and appearance over time. Also, the main advantage of CPL lies in its ability to adapt to any shape. It even allows for a 1mm radius of curvature, making it a versatile option for more complex and daring designs.
Both Finish Foil and CPL offer a wide variety of designs and finishes that allow fabricators to experiment with different styles and trends. From classic wood finishes to modern colours and sophisticated textures, these coatings provide flexibility in creating custom furniture to suit market demands and customer tastes.
The application of these coatings is an important process in furniture manufacturing. Before applying Finish Foil or CPL, the surface of the furniture must be properly prepared. Ensuring that it is clean and free of irregularities to obtain an optimum finish. Finish Foil is applied by a process of pressure and heat, ensuring a strong and uniform bond to the surface of the furniture. CPL, on the other hand, is applied using a laminating press. It is subjected to high temperatures and pressure to ensure adhesion and create a durable and resistant coating.

In the world of interior design and decoration, wallpaper and decorative paper are elements that add personality and style to spaces. For decades, interior designers have used both materials to enhance the appearance of furniture, doors, walls and other surfaces. While they may appear similar at first glance, there are significant differences in their application and purpose.
Decorative paper is responsible for giving the original look and feel to the furniture pieces and doors we buy in the market. Panel makers, carpenters and furniture manufacturers use this material in the manufacturing process, which allows them to achieve pieces with a unique style.
It originated as a creative alternative to traditional wallpaper. With the advancement of printing technology, it is now possible to create high quality designs and stunning details on decorative paper. This type of paper can be printed in different textures and finishes, which adds depth and realism to the images, such as wood, stone, fantasy and unicolour.
Unlike wallpaper, which is used to renew the look of existing furniture, doors and walls, decorative paper is applied in the initial manufacturing process. It is used to cover all types of surfaces, including furniture, doors, panels, mouldings and profiles.
Decorative paper is manufactured in a wide range of designs, finishes and textures, giving it different characteristics and appearances. From woodgrain papers to more modern and contemporary designs, decorative paper offers endless options to suit different decorative styles.
Wallpaper is a popular and versatile option for renovating furniture, doors and walls in our spaces. It has a wide variety of designs and patterns that allow you to experiment with different styles and aesthetics without replacing complete pieces. From its beginnings in ancient China, where hand-painted rice paper was used, wallpaper has evolved into a variety of materials such as paper, vinyl and fabric, each with unique characteristics and benefits. With its centuries-old history and versatility, it continues to be a popular form of interior decoration for adding style and personality to spaces.

Laminates are composite materials made by bonding several layers of paper impregnated with resins and subjected to high pressure and temperature. This combination of layers gives laminates greater strength and durability compared to natural wood.

Finish foil, also known as decorative foil, is an outstanding material in the field of surface coating. It is a thin paper foil impregnated with resins and coated with a protective layer for strength and durability. Finish foil offers a wide variety of designs and finishes, making it a popular choice for adding a decorative look to various types of furniture.
Finish foil is widely used in the furniture industry as it offers an effective and versatile solution for surface coating. Some of the most common applications include the coating of furniture, doors, cabinet fronts, mouldings and profiles as well as the creation of decorative panels.
One of the main advantages of the is its durability and strength. Despite its delicate appearance, this material is able to withstand knocks, scratches and other types of wear and tear, thanks to the protective coating finish. In addition, finish foil offers a wide range of designs and finishes to suit different styles and preferences.
Another important advantage of finish foil is its ease of installation and maintenance. It can be applied to a variety of substrates, such as chipboard or MDF, using pressing or gluing techniques. In addition, its smooth, non-porous surface makes it easy to clean and maintain on a daily basis, without the need for special products.

Durability and strength
Lamidecor’s decorative laminates are recognized for their durability and strength. These materials are designed to withstand daily use and resist wear and tear over time. The combination of paper layers impregnated with synthetic resins and the high temperature and pressure process to which they are subjected during their manufacture gives them a solid and resistant structure.
They are capable of resisting knocks, scratches and dents, making them an ideal choice for areas of high traffic and intense use. In addition, they are resistant to stains and fading, ensuring that they retain their original appearance for many years.
Their durability is also enhanced by their ability to resist moisture and weathering. Lamidecor’s decorative laminates are designed to be resistant to environmental humidity, preventing them from warping or deteriorating over time.
In addition, these laminates are easy to clean and maintain. Their smooth, non-porous surface prevents the accumulation of dirt and facilitates cleaning with a damp cloth and mild detergents. They do not require specialized maintenance, making them a convenient, low-maintenance option for any space.
